Basic Vector Information
- Vector Name:
- pGad
- Antibiotic Resistance:
- Kanamycin
- Length:
- 9175 bp
- Type:
- Plasmid vector
- Replication origin:
- p15A ori
- Source/Author:
- Dharmasena MN, Stark CEC., Stibitz S, Kopecko DJ.
- Promoter:
- araBAD

FEATURES Location/Qualifiers
source 1..9175
/mol_type="other DNA"
/organism="synthetic DNA construct"
rep_origin 480..1025
/label="p15A ori"
/note="Plasmids containing the medium-copy-number p15A
origin of replication can be propagated in E. coli cells
that contain a second plasmid with the ColE1 origin."
CDS 1620..2432
/label="KanR"
/note="aminoglycoside phosphotransferase"
CDS complement(3053..3928)
/label="araC"
/note="L-arabinose regulatory protein"
promoter 3955..4239
/label="araBAD promoter"
/note="promoter of the L-arabinose operon of E. coli; the
araC regulatory gene is transcribed in the opposite
direction (Guzman et al., 1995)"
CDS 4267..5664
/gene="gadA"
/label="Glutamate decarboxylase alpha"
/note="Glutamate decarboxylase alpha from Escherichia coli
(strain K12). Accession#: P69908"
CDS 5716..7113
/gene="gadB"
/label="Glutamate decarboxylase beta"
/note="Glutamate decarboxylase beta from Escherichia coli
(strain K12). Accession#: P69910"
CDS 7138..8670
/gene="gadC"
/label="Glutamate/gamma-aminobutyrate antiporter"
/note="Glutamate/gamma-aminobutyrate antiporter from
Escherichia coli (strain K12). Accession#: P63235"
terminator 8906..8992
/label="rrnB T1 terminator"
/note="transcription terminator T1 from the E. coli rrnB
gene"
terminator 9084..9111
/label="rrnB T2 terminator"
/note="transcription terminator T2 from the E. coli rrnB
gene"
